Had first slot of the day at a local festival, only crowd were nearby strollers and a musician friend (Hey Alec!), so I tested 2-cam shooting triggered with bluetooth remotes. Audio is 2 iPhone mics mixed together and automatically synced by Final Cut Pro (great shortcut).

Next plans are to add live the board feed as primary audio and try mixing in iPhone mic as ambient audio. I'm also adding a camera mount that auto-follows an infra red emitter on the back on the headstock. It'll follow me wherever I move. I hope to have two eventually. I'm adding some lights next week for better indoor video, and might add headstock cam as 3rd perspective to add interest.

Great job. I think it looks good, and you're definitely on the right track. I don't know what Final Cut Pro has to offer for video editing, I've been using Adobe Premier. But one trick I do to make 2 cameras look like 6 is zoom in a lot on various shots. So you could take the front camera and zoom in on just your face. Then take the same camera and zoom in on the slide playing. Now it looks like you have 3 cameras in front of you. A little more time consuming, but like most things, you get quicker with the editing the more you do it. I do the zooming when I edit. The resolution isn't as good on the zoom, but I don't stay on those shots that long.
